Special Category For AP Dominates YS Jagan-Modi Talks

New Delhi: Terming as positive the one-hour long meeting with Prime Minister Narendra Modi,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ister-designate Sri YS Jagan Mohan Reddy said that the dire economic situation and the need for Special Category Status (SCS) took the prime time of summit meeting.

Speaking to media after the meeting, YS Jagan Mohan Reddy has said, ‘the Prime Minister gave a patient hearing and looked positive during the meeting in which the state of affairs was briefed to him. Though NDA has a clear mandate and has absolute majority on its own and does not need our support, we have asked him to be magnanimous in helping the state that is orphaned with the bifurcation and was pushed into a debt trap by the mal-governance of the previous government.

SCS is the lifeline and necessary for the state. Despite my silent prayer to deprive the Centre of absolute majority, there was an overwhelming mandate for the NDA and what we could do now is to pursue the issue in a sustained manner and keep on prodding the issue whenever and wherever we meet the Prime Minister.

The debt burden of the state is very high and it has increased from Rs 97, 000 crores in 2014 to Rs 2.58 lakh crores now shattering the financial position which was told to the Prime Minister and I hope that he would show the magnanimity to helping us in every possible way, he said.

The Prime Minister listened to my narrative and was very positive and I hope that it would yield results in the coming days.

The Chief Minister designate and YSR Congress President had met Prime Minister and BJP President Sri Amit Shah apprising them of the situation in the state that has empty coffers, heavy debt and little prospects of development.

The SCS was promised on the floor of the house and was approved by the Cabinet which has become an executive decision and the talk of 14thFinance Commission and other such lame excuses were proved wrong. We merit the SCS which was announced in lieu of foregoing Hyderabad where all the development and resources are highly concentrated.

Perhaps this is the first time that a state seeking bifurcation could take away the capital with and Andhra Pradesh stood at a loss on fronts. It is for this reason that we deserve SCS which will get exemptions and investments which will propel job opportunities to the youth.

On the corruption charges and irregularities of Chandrababu Naidu government, he said there would be a review and white papers would be released after a detailed study. We will ensure that there will be a corruption free governance and we will show to people the model of good governance, he said.

Completion of Polavaram project is important for the state and will explore all means to complete it and we will go for reverse tenders if needed.

He said that only he will take oath on May 30 and the team would be inducted later.
